Description:

Increase your productivity with the speed and efficiency of the HP Officejet 5610. Now you can do it all - print, fax, copy and scan - from this compact, versatile all-in-one solution from HP. Create professional presentations and brochures with laser-quality black text, plus optional 6-ink and 4800 optimized dpi color when you print and copy color documents. Send important faxes quickly and eliminate unwanted faxes using junk-fax barrier.Conveniently copy, scan and fax multiple pages with 25-sheet auto document feeder. Use glass surface to easily scan from virtually any source - books, reports, photos and more - at 1200 x 2400 dpi optical resolution, 48-bit color. Get the job done quickly with print and copy speeds up to 20 ppm black, up to 13 ppm color. The intuitive control panel with one-touch buttons and two-line text display make it easy to reduce or enlarge documents, scan images and more without a computer. As always, count on HP reliability for consistent performance.

Features:

All-in-one thermal inkjet unit prints, scans, faxes, and copies


Print and copy speeds of up to 20 ppm black & white and 13 ppm color


Built-in scanner scans images in 48-bit color at up to 1200 dpi


100-sheet paper tray and 25-sheet automatic document feeder


Measures 17.13 x 16.46 x 9.25 inches; weighs 13 pounds; 1-year limited warranty

3Doesn't lastFeb 19, 2010
Positives...
You get all the essential features for an affordable price.
Ink replacements are not expensive, if you order them online.
Full driver support for CUPS (Linux & Mac)

Negatives...
When you tell it to scan off the glass, it takes a while to get itself ready to start, regardless of density chosen.
The page feeder stopped working on me right at about one year after purchase. I buy multifunction printers continuously for several small businesses, and regardless of brand name, usage, dusting, and being on UPS, they rarely last two years before something goes out. So, this is by no means below average.

Overall...
It was worth the money.

5Nice printerFeb 13, 2010
I've been using this printer at home for about a year and have had no problems. The included software worked fine with Vista, and even includes a fax driver so you can print to fax with progams like Microsoft Word (apparently not included with Vista Home Premium). Black ink seems to last forever on economy setting, long after the indicator on the screen shows empty.
